Here I am looking at H6 Spec.B's.. are they as powerful as the turbo ones??

 

Overall power is probably a bit less. It really the torque and the RPM it's delivered at that makes the difference.

 

H6's make reasonable power.

Their best feature is they a butter smooth and rev like crazy.

 

 

Oh, and THAT SOUND!!!!!

Looks OK and a nice colour.

 

Stability control and no SatNav? Double check it has stabilty.

 

Check the 100k service was done too. (nevermind, just read that)

 

Maybe check the T belt was actually done, not just an oil change by the dealer.
